Differences in biologics for treating ankylosing spondylitis: the contribution of network meta-analysis
A Migliore1, G Gigliucci, D Integlia
1Operative Unit of Rheumatology, San Pietro Fatebenefratelli Hospital, Rome, Italy. migliore.alberto60@gmail.com.
Objective:
Ankylosing Spondylitis (AS) is a chronic form of arthritis of unknown origin affecting the spine. In this study, we aimed to identify clinical and safety profiles of adalimumab, certolizumab pegol, etanercept, golimumab, infliximab, and secukinumab that are biologic agents (biologics) mainly used for the treatment of AS, and to understand differences between them.
Materials And Methods:
An extensive literature research was performed in MEDLINE and EMBASE in order to identify all network meta-analysis (NMA) and/or mixed treatment comparison (MTC) papers. NMA and/or MTC, with a ranking of the effectiveness of biologics in AS, were included in the analysis, and the adhesion to ISPOR guidelines was investigated.
Results:
60 studies were identified; after applying exclusion criteria methods, 7 studies underwent further analysis. Infliximab was the drug that exhibited the highest probability for achieving clinical efficacy by ASAS20 at 12 and 24 weeks. Considering only subcutaneous biologics, Golimumab achieved the highest probability for achieving the ASAS20 response at 12 weeks.
Conclusions:
Results from NMA on the use of biologics in AS indicates infliximab emerged as the drug with the highest probability of obtaining ASAS20 response both at 12 and 24 weeks of treatment.
